Douglas Trumbull
Visual-effects pioneer who, as one of four Special Photographic Effects Supervisors on '2001: A Space Odyssey' (alongside Wally Veevers, Con Pederson, and Tom Howard), conceived (with Kubrick) the slit-scan photography that became the Stargate sequence. Spielberg sought him out for the very first effects work on 'Close Encounters of the Third Kind'. Later went on to direct 'Silent Running' and 'Brainstorm', and pioneered Showscan.
